CIMARRON U.S. ARTILLERY MODEL Description

.45 LC cal., 5 1/2 in. barrel, Rinaldo A. Carr 1895 U.S. Artillery Model Commemorative. Limited mfg.

CIMARRON MAN WITH NO NAME SAA

.45 LC cal., 4 3/4 or 5 1/2 in. barrel, case hardened pre-war frame, one-piece walnut grip with silver rattlesnake inlay on both sides, standard blue finish, approx. 2 3/4 lbs. Mfg. by Uberti. Disc. 2014.

CIMARRON BUCKHORN

.44 Spl. or .44 Mag. cal., reinforced variation of the Cimarron SAA designed for more powerful cartridges, 4 3/4, 6, or 7 1/2 in. barrel, brass or steel backstrap, mfg. by Uberti. Disc. 1993.
